Analysis

Northern Africa recorded 121.07 for dates — gross production index number in 2024. That is the highest value across all 64 years on record.

The figure is up 1.9% on the previous year and up 27.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, dates — gross production index number in Northern Africa peaked at 121.07 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 18.8, in 1962.

Northern Africa ranks 9th of 20 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
